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8469223170 02660393 52986576229
47679 74360 4586338515
47679 74360 4586338515
1722 79946 07510 8067138
All about undefined
Interested in learning more?
47679 74360 4586338515
1722 79946 07510 8067138
See more
83064 93475
3724725680 113 1856269
See more
08 65542443867 69
332 82841284 9474732 885027829
See more